Asphaltite and Asfaltita
Asphaltite, also called asfaltita in Spanish, is often a naturally taking place stable bitumen. It is a hydrocarbon-primarily based mineral that kinds with the biodegradation of petroleum around lengthy periods. Asphaltite is typically black, brittle, and extremely viscous, making it distinct from softer petroleum items like crude oil or asphalt. Its significant carbon written content and small sulfur content allow it to be specifically useful in many industrial programs.
One among the principal employs of asphaltite is in street building. In contrast to standard asphalt, that is derived from refining crude oil, asphaltite provides a naturally developing binder for pavements. Its longevity and resistance to deformation beneath large temperatures allow it to be perfect for highways, airport runways, and industrial flooring. On top of that, asphaltite is Utilized in manufacturing electrodes, waterproofing products, and in many cases being a fuel in certain Strength manufacturing procedures.
The mining of asphaltite calls for cautious extraction procedures. It generally occurs in veins or deposits in just sedimentary rocks. Mining operations must harmony efficiency with environmental things to consider, guaranteeing minimum influence on surrounding ecosystems when maximizing resource recovery.
Gilsonite
Gilsonite is yet another type of purely natural asphalt, closely connected to asphaltite, but with exclusive industrial importance. It really is observed mainly in The usa, notably in Utah, and is commonly known as “uintaite” in selected regions. Gilsonite is shiny, black, and brittle, with large carbon written content, making it very combustible.
Gilsonite’s apps increase beyond building. It truly is greatly used in the production of inks, paints, and coatings on account of its binding Houses. Its power to adhere well to surfaces and resist water makes it ideal for specialty items for example printing inks, asphalt modifiers, and foundry sand binders. Also, gilsonite is Employed in the oil and fuel field as a drilling additive to improve the efficiency of drilling fluids.
The extraction of gilsonite involves each surface and underground mining. Surface mining is common exactly where deposits are close to the ground, while underground mining is used for further veins. The mining procedure should think about each safety and environmental impact, as gilsonite is very flammable and might release dangerous fumes if improperly taken care of.
Graphite and Grafito
Graphite, often called grafito in Spanish, is usually a Obviously taking place type of crystalline carbon. It is renowned for its one of a kind Houses, which includes higher thermal and electrical conductivity, chemical inertness, and lubricating ability. Graphite is smooth, slippery, and metallic gray in appearance, which makes it flexible for varied industrial programs.
One of the most acquainted utilizes of graphite is in pencils, where by it serves since the writing core. Further than stationery, graphite is vital in industries such as steel output, in which it is actually employed to be a refractory materials, and from the manufacturing of batteries, notably lithium-ion batteries, which power electrical cars and moveable electronics. Graphite also finds applications in lubricants, brake linings, and substantial-temperature crucibles as a consequence of its resistance to heat and chemical attack.
Mining graphite includes extracting the mineral from metamorphic rocks where by it Normally happens in veins or levels. The two open up-pit and underground mining approaches are used, dependant upon the deposit depth and geography. Environmental management is vital for the duration of graphite mining, as dust technology and chemical use can effects local ecosystems.
Limestone and Caliza
Limestone, or caliza in Spanish, is really a sedimentary rock mostly composed of calcium carbonate (CaCO₃). It kinds in excess of a lot of decades within the accumulation of shells, coral, and other maritime organisms. Limestone is ample and has long been a cornerstone of design and producing for hundreds of years.
In building, limestone is actually a crucial ingredient in cement and concrete, providing toughness and longevity to constructions. Additionally it is utilized for road foundation content, dimension stone in buildings, and attractive stonework. Industrially, limestone serves in metal manufacturing as a flux to eliminate impurities, in glass creation, and in chemical procedures like the creation of lime and calcium carbonate powders.
Limestone mining is often carried out through open up-pit strategies, which permit for that effective extraction of huge quantities of rock. The environmental impacts consist of landscape alteration, dust emissions, and opportunity drinking water contamination, that are managed as a result of rehabilitation, dust suppression, and drinking water treatment devices.
